MISCELLANEOUS LOT OF 19TH CENTURY EDGED WEAPONS.1) Scare and fine condition model 1818 Starr NCO sword with fine original scabbard with frog button retaining most of its original black finish. 25-3/4" blade is well marked "N.STARR / US / P / L.S." (inspector Luther Sage). SIZE: PROVENANCE: Outstanding estate collection of Confederate and historical arms of Morris Racker. CONDITION: 1) Very good overall and much better than normally encountered, full leather grip, though dry and cracking. Blade is overall gray with staining and pitting. Original leather washer. Balance of metal mottled iron patina. Scabbard as noted retains 95% of its original black finish. 51958-39 JS (1,500-2,500)

Early 18th-19th century angular bayonet with indiscernible engraving on socket. 3) Pipe tomahawk with well patinaed head. 4) Bamboo swagger stick with concealed 12" dagger. 5) Indo-Persian all metal horse-headed Mughal-style swagger stick with silver inlaid design and concealed daggers on both ends. 6 & 7) Two child's swords, one is Imperial German. 8) Espada Ancha with branched guard. SIZE: PROVENANCE: Outstanding estate collection of Confederate and historical arms of Morris Racker. CONDITION: Condition on other objects is good to very good overall. Espada Ancha is typically well patinaed with weathered wood grip and guard is loose. 51958-41 JS (800-1,200)
